Also see . . . Morgan Hill Historical Society: Centennial History Trail .
"The Morgan Hill Centennial History Trail was created to celebrate the 100th anniversary of the incorporation of the City of Morgan Hill. Starting at the center marker and then proceeding along an expanding spiral trail, you will pass approximately 100 raised post markers describing events in the history of Morgan Hill and the surrounding area."(Submitted on January 4, 2023, by Joseph Alvarado of Livermore, California.)
